Propofol, a potent anesthetic administered via IV that leaves people in a largely comatose state, has become the controversial drug du jour since it was discovered in Jackson’s Holmby Hills mansion.
Federal regulators are considering adding the drug to their official list of controlled substances, which would require hospitals to account for every drop used.
County officials have confirmed that Jackson was taking prescription medications when he died, but they aren’t expected to make public their full report until at least next week because of the ongoing, possibly criminal investigation into the circumstances surrounding Jackson’s untimely demise.
The private autopsy was performed June 27, two days after Jackson died and the day following the coroner’s examination of the body.
